Another of Jasper's highlights was also a gift given to him by Heather.

She gave him The Dangerous Book for Boys by Conn and Hal Iggulden. As soon as he opened the book his eyes got HUGE. It tells boys how to do wonderful things like fold paper airplanes, build a go-cart, what the rules of rugby are, how to use Morse code, how to build a tree house, coin tricks, etc.

One of my favorite parts from the book reads:

ADVICE ABOUT GIRLS

You may already have noticed that girls are quite different fro m you. By this, we do not mean the physical differences, more the fact that they remain unimpressed by your master of a game involving wizards, or your understanding of Morse code. Some will be impressed, of course, but as a general rule, girls do not get quite as excited by the use of urine as a secret ink as boys do.
